Discrepancy



You'd have seen two boys, smile up out
Morn's own features! Thereupon
Expansive-hearted, bear for day
What through secrets bursts its way.

Always coming back, track narrowed;
Breath tightened. A sense, heavy
Of a clamping down, with malice
O'er sounds' forbidding notice.
